About Us: Humanscale is a leading designer and manufacturer of ergonomic products that improve health and comfort at work. We are committed to sustainability and have a focus on reducing our environmental impact.

Responsibilities:
  • Support Production Lines: Minimize or eliminate downtime by providing technical support and guidance to production teams.
  • Manage Engineering Changes: Develop and implement changes to products and processes to improve manufacturability and reduce costs.
  • Ensure Manufacturability: Participate in the product design and development process to ensure that products are manufacturable and meet quality standards.
  • Provide Technical Support: Offer technical assistance to customers, sales, customer service, and Humanscale technicians for new and existing products.
  • Identify Cost Reduction Opportunities: Analyze processes and identify opportunities for cost reductions and implement initiatives to achieve savings.
  • Collaborate with Vendors: Work with vendors and suppliers to procure materials and components, and ensure that technical specifications are met.
  • Design Customized Prototypes: Design and develop customized prototypes and final functional units to satisfy customer special order requests.
  • Perform BOM Accuracy Audits: Conduct audits to ensure that Bills of Material (BOM) are accurate and up-to-date.
Requirements:
  • Education: Bachelor's or Master's degree in Mechanical Engineering or a related field.
  • Experience: Internship experience working in an engineering capacity at a manufacturing facility.
  • Skills: Knowledge of engineering principles, practices, and techniques commonly employed in the design and production of products. Experienced in using 3D CAD modeling software (e.g. Solidworks). Excellent organizational, analytical, and interpersonal skills.
  • Language: Bilingual in Spanish and English preferred.
  • Physical Demands: Ability to lift 60 pounds and perform repetitive bending and stretching.
Benefits:
  • Competitive Salary: Competitive salary based on experience.
  • Medical Benefits: Medical, dental, and vision benefits.
  • Retirement Plan: 401(k) with employer matching.
  • Paid Time Off: 15 PTO days and 10 holidays per year.
